A coaching call with someone reminds me and perhaps you of how destructive the lies we tell ourselves can be.

 

I want to talk with you today about the lies you tell yourself.

One thing I know about most people is (there are exceptions because Lord knows, there are sociopaths out there) that we try to be remarkably honest in their relationships with friends, family, and the world at large.  We try to be honest with coworkers.  We try to do our best.  We try to communicate accurately, and ably. 

Then there is the part where we talk to ourselves and then those voices within our head tell us lies.  Lies that we took on from other people. 

I was talking with someone today who is telling himself the long way that he could not make any money.  That he was “financially unable.”  What happened?  As we spoke about, his father had had that struggle.  His father had expressed time and again that “if only she and her brother had done something differently, he wouldn’t have to agonize and be frustrated” and all that kind of stuff. Out of care for her father, she took on the line that maybe she should make any money.

What lies have you taken on?  What messages do you give to yourself that are pure fiction that are coming out of an episode from earlier in your life where out of care for someone or a misinterpretation of the message, you are hurting yourself?

Think about.

You are hurting yourself by taking on these messages that are just pure fiction.

You can start working on this by yourself by saying, ” Ah! That’s interesting!  Is that 1 of those voices?”  Or 1 of those interruptions that causes you to question the voice.  You can also work with a coach.  I, of course, were someone else   That will help you dissect and help you work in different directions.
